Yes OS: Windows 10 Pro | CPU: AMD Ryzen 7 3700X 8-Core Processor | GPU: NVIDIA GeForce RTX 2060 | RAM: 32 gig Severity: (med/low). low because it doesn't impact gameplay, however could be medium, or high if issue is causing added memory load Frequency: high. reproducible v0.1.4.0.26521 While testing to see at what altitude debris/spacecraft auto deletes, I found an interesting bug. If you set as target a piece of debris before it deletes, and you set your SAS to point at it, it will remain floating in space at the distance and attitude at which it dissappeared. In the picture provided, the target indicator did not move at all in reference to the current space craft. To recreate the bug: Launch a spacecraft with discardable parts that you can release into a decaying orbit in atmosphere. Set one of those parts as target wait for the target to pass 55km in altitudde and be deleted watch indicator remain on targets last position in reference to the spacecraft I'm unsure if this object is remaining persistent in the game, or if it is actually being deleted, but a reload does remove said target (though i'm not sure if it is actually removed from the game) Included Attachments:

Yes OS: Windows 11 | CPU: Intel i5 | GPU: AMD 6700XT | RAM: 16GB Hello, I have a five-year old daughter who loves to play KSP1. But, she really struggles with KSP2. Her small hands have very shaky mouse control. I have the mouse DPI turned way down, so she needs to move her hand a looong way physically to cross the screen, but even so, the VAB is basically unusable for her. The problem is that it seems to click on a part, you have to do a mouse-down and mouse-up without moving the mouse at all. For some people (young children, maybe others) that isn't possible. If you mouse-down, move a millimeter, then mouse-up, it's treated as a failed drag-and-drop. What's doubly-insulting is that it doesn't even pick the part up. She'll try ten times just to pick up a part from the menu on the left, but each time she tries to click, it's just treated as if she dropped the part back on the menu, and it doesn't get picked up as a result. So frustrating for her. Similarly, placing parts on the center of the screen is near-impossible, due to the same issue. Please fix it so that the VAB can be used by my children.
